Cole Mattin is an Assistant Coach at Milwaukee School of Engineering, a position he has held since 2023. He is a former University of Michigan wrestler (2019-2023) who earned 4 varsity letters and was a member of the 2022 Big Ten championship team and NCAA national runners-up squad. Mattin was a 3x Academic All-Big Ten selection and NWCA All-Academic Team member, earning Michigan's Big Ten Postgraduate Scholarship. He competed at 141 pounds and qualified for the NCAA tournament in 2023. A graduate of the University of Michigan with a Bachelor of Science in Biology, Health and Society, Mattin is currently a third-year student at Marquette University School of Dentistry. He comes from a wrestling family, with two brothers who wrestled at Michigan and another brother currently competing at Stanford University.

Helton Vandenbush is an Assistant Coach at Milwaukee School of Engineering, a position he has held since 2024. He is a former MSOE wrestler (2017-2021) who earned 4 varsity letters and was a 4x NWCA Academic All-American. As a wrestler, he won the 2018 CCIW Conference Championship at 174 lbs and earned DIII NWCA All-American honors at 184 lbs in 2021. Before joining MSOE's coaching staff, Vandenbush served as an assistant coach at Random Lake High School, where he was named the 2024 Big East Conference Coach of the Year. He holds a Bachelor of Science in Mechanical Engineering from MSOE and currently works as a Senior Design Engineer at Milwaukee Tool.

Kyle Plank is an Assistant Coach at Milwaukee School of Engineering, a position he has held since 2024. He wrestled for the University of Wisconsin - La Crosse from 2019-2024. Plank graduated from the University of Wisconsin - La Crosse with a degree in Information Systems.

Matt Vandenbush is an Assistant Coach at MSOE (2024-Present) with 19 years of wrestling and coaching experience. He served as Head Coach at Random Lake High School for 8 seasons (2005-2008, 2019-2024) and as an Assistant Coach for 11 seasons. During his tenure, he led the program to 13 trips to Team State, 14 conference titles, 20 individual state finalists, 10 state champions, and 54 individual state place winners. He holds a B.S. in Computer Engineering from MSOE and currently serves as CIO at Brady Corporation in Milwaukee, WI.
